The participating localities creating the Authority are the City of Martinsville <br />and the County of Henry, both independent political subdivisions of the Commonwealth <br />of Virginia. <br /> <br />Article 5. The Authority's purposes will include acquiring, financing, constructing, <br />owning and operating public recreational facilities in Martinsville and Henry County, and <br />to that end it will have all statutory powers granted by the Act. Any project permitted <br />under the Act shall be an eligible project for the Authority. Consistent with the Act, no <br />future obligation ofthe Authority shall constitute a debt or pledge of the full faith and <br />credit of the Commonwealth of Virginia, the County of Henry or the City of Martinsville, <br /> <br />Article 6. Box 1112 <br />Martinsville VA 24114 <br /> <br />They, and their respective successors in office as county administrator and city manager, <br />shall serve as members ex officio, who shall be entitled to participate as full, voting <br />members. Their terms on the Authority shall be concurrent with their respective terms of <br />employment as county administrator and city manager. <br /> <br />Following the adoption of these articles of incorporation, each Local Governing Body <br />shall appoint three additional residents of its locality, and a fourth resident of the locality <br />nominated by the Harvest Foundation of the Piedmont, to serve as voting members of the <br />board of directors. Notwithstanding the provisions of the Act, such voting members shall <br />not be officers or employees of the City or County governments, <br /> <br />Two of each locality's initial appointees shall be appointed for a term of two years, and <br />the other two, including the Harvest Foundation's nominees, shall be appointed for a term <br />of four years. Subsequent appointments shall be for full four-year terms, or to fill <br />vacancies for the unexpired current term. No member shall serve more than two full four- <br />year terms. <br /> <br />Article 7. All members of the board of directors shall serve without compensation, but <br />may be reimbursed by the Authority for their actual expenses incurred in the course of <br />their duties.
